Is this normal? Recently, when I take C's night nappy off in the morning, it smells so strongly of ammonia that the fumes are making my eyes water. I'm having to do a mini strip wash every time I wash or everything stinks. She drinks plenty of water from her sippy cup(well she throws a lot of it around but I'm pretty sure some goes down) and she's also BF on demand too so I think she's getting enough fluids.
 
its normal for night nappies to smell a bit more strong in the morning, my toddlers one just made my eyes water, since they are fitteds i guess we could soak them in Napisan or something similar and that would help but i wouldnt soak anything with PUL
 
It could also be associated with teething, i find Alexs nappies smell so much more when hes teething.
 
I ws just going to say the same as AG, my LOs smell very strong when he is teething xx
 
Same here, Caine stinks some days! :sick: I think its down to teething x
 
yep, some mornings P's are enough to burn your eyes out. :lol:
 
Same with Emma's- I find it's not just teething, but also related to weaning. We never never had stinky morning nappies until she started on solids and I noticed that certain foods make for stinkier pee (spag bol being the worse so far). We started to rinse the morning pee nappies before putting them in the pail so that the ammonia smell wouldn't set in as badly.
 
I find that using wool or fleece instead of PUL wraps makes night nappies less stinky. Also make sure you unstuff them completely before putting them in the wash even if you don't normally bother, as it really helps to get rid of the smell.

what is a strip wash?!
 
Wash your nappies with a full load of powder, then rinse and rinse and rinse until no bubbles. I use a bit of soda crystals too x
 
Or you can use a dishwasher tablet in the drum, and do an extra rinse (or two). That works for us :D I think if I used a full scoop of detergent, our water is so soft that I'd be rinsing for weeks :rofl:
